William M. Morgan, 83,

Dies at Nursing Home

William M. Morgan, 83, retired Muncie glassworker who resided at 608 E, Ninth St., died Thurs­day noon at Rest Haven Nursing Home on Bethel Pike following an extended illness.

Funeral rites will be held at 2 p.m. Saturday at Meeks Mortu­ary, with the Rev. Robert G. Sulanke officiating. Burial will be in Beech Grove Cemetery. Friends may call at the mortuary.

Mr. Morgan, a native of Madi­son County, O., spent most of his life in this community. He was formerly an employe of Ball Brothers Co. and the old Hemingray Glass Co., now the Kimble Glass Co. He was a member of Eagles Lodge.

Surviving are a daughter, Mrs. Ethel Pfeiffer of Muncie; two sons, Robert U. Morgan of Rich­mond and John W. Morgan of Muncie; three grandchildren, and two great-grandchildren. His wife died here June 30, 1952.
